Examining the Damages



When faced with water damages, the very first crucial step is evaluating the degree of the damages. A detailed assessment involves identifying the resource of the water intrusion, which could range from a ruptured pipe to natural flooding. Understanding the beginning helps identify the necessary removal measures. Next, inspect the impacted locations for noticeable indicators of damages, such as staining, bending, or mold and mildew growth. Pay close attention to floor covering, wall surfaces, and ceilings, as these products are specifically vulnerable to moisture.


Additionally, it is crucial to assess the duration of exposure to water. Products that have actually been wet for an extensive period are likely to receive much more severe damage and might need replacement as opposed to repair. Documenting the damages with photographs can offer important evidence for insurance claims and repair professionals.


Last but not least, think about the potential health risks connected with water damages, consisting of the development of mold and mildew and pollutants. This evaluation not only help in developing a feedback method however also makes certain the safety of residents. By methodically examining the damages, house owners can better comprehend the extent of the problem and prepare for the subsequent steps in the clean-up procedure.


Water Elimination Methods



Efficient water removal is crucial in mitigating damage and protecting against more problems such as mold and mildew development. The very first step in this process involves recognizing the resource of water breach, which might be from flooding, leakages, or other aspects. When the resource is dealt with, numerous strategies can be used for effective water elimination.


One typical technique is utilizing completely submersible pumps, which are suitable for removing standing water in larger locations. These pumps can efficiently draw out substantial quantities of water quickly. For smaller, extra confined rooms, wet/dry vacuums are often used to take care of residual moisture properly.

Drying and Dehumidification



Successful drying out and dehumidification are vital parts in the healing process adhering to water damages. As soon as the first water elimination has actually been completed, the emphasis shifts to extensively drying the influenced locations to prevent more concerns such as mold and mildew development and structural damage.


The drying out process generally involves the use of customized tools, consisting of high-capacity air moving companies and dehumidifiers, which function in tandem to promote airflow and lower humidity levels. water damage restoration. Air movers help distribute air to help with evaporation, while dehumidifiers remove wetness from the air, thus lowering humidity and increasing the drying process

Keeping track of moisture levels throughout this phase is critical. Experts utilize moisture meters to examine the performance of drying efforts and make sure that all products, consisting of walls, floors, and furnishings, are adequately dried. In some cases, thermal imaging cams might likewise be employed to identify concealed dampness pockets within walls or ceilings.


Usually, the drying procedure can take numerous days to complete, depending on the level of the water damages and ecological conditions. Properly implemented drying out and dehumidification not only safeguard your home but also lead the way for succeeding cleansing and reconstruction efforts.




Cleansing and Disinfecting



Cleaning up and sterilizing are crucial steps in the water damage remediation process, as they ensure that influenced areas are devoid of impurities and pathogens. After drying and dehumidification, the cleaning phase involves the elimination of debris, dust, and any kind of residual wetness that might nurture unsafe bacteria. Professional-grade anti-bacterials are usually used to make certain extensive sanitization. These products must be applied according to producer instructions, thinking about elements such as call time and dilution rates. Unique interest has to be offered to permeable products, such as carpetings and drywall, which might need specialized cleaning strategies or replacement if heavily infected.


Furthermore, high-touch surfaces, such as light buttons and doorknobs, must be focused on throughout the cleaning procedure to decrease health risks. By thoroughly cleaning and sanitizing water-damaged locations, homeowners can substantially decrease the threat of mold and mildew development and guarantee a secure environment for residents.


Preventing Future Issues



House owners' vigilance is crucial in protecting against future water damage concerns. Additionally, inspecting roof rain gutters and downspouts consistently can stop water from pooling near the foundation, which may result in significant water intrusion.


Proper landscape design is another crucial element. Ensure that the ground slopes away from your home's structure to promote water drainage. Take into consideration mounting a French drain or sump pump in locations vulnerable to flooding.


In addition, be aggressive in checking moisture degrees inside your home. Making use of dehumidifiers in moist areas, such as basements and creep spaces, can considerably decrease the threat of mold development and structural damages.




Finally, buy top quality materials and technologies, such as water leak detection systems, which can notify you to concerns prior to they escalate. By carrying out these preventative procedures, home owners can significantly decrease the chance of future water damage, securing their building and preserving its value. Regular assessments and a commitment to upkeep will give satisfaction and defense against unpredicted water-related calamities.
